Tomra Systems ASA Business Description

Address Drengsrudhagen 2, Asker, NOR, 1385
Tomra Systems ASA provides sorting and recycling solutions to equip customers for handling waste. The company creates and delivers sensor-based solutions that contribute to optimal resource productivity, in packaging, collection, compaction, recycling, ore sorting, and food production. It provides reverse vending machines, sensor-based sorting machines integrated post-harvest solutions, sensors for waste sorting applications, and other related products and solutions. The company's operating segments are; TOMRA Collection which generates key revenue, TOMRA Recycling, TOMRA Horizon, and TOMRA Food. Geographically, the company generates maximum revenue from Europe region followed by America, Asia, and Oceania.
